[quote=Anonymous]I got a call today ostensibly from AmEx. They had details on my account (including my most recent payment) and said they were calling about a questionable charge ($1200 at a Walmart in NY.) I bought the story and gave them my full credit card number and the last 4 of my SSN. I know better but they had some information, like my most recent payment, that made it seem credible. I got suspicious and called AmEx from a separate line - which clarified that this was a scam. I cancelled my AmEx card immediately and put a fraud alert and freeze on my credit report. Is there anything else I can/should do to keep this from morphing into something worse? Thanks!![/quote]
